Kick-off Christmas with limited-time pop-up restaurant

Dust off the stockings and deck the halls, Christmas has come early with the launch of a pop-up restaurant dedicated to the most wonderful time of the year.

For three nights only, from 6 – 8 November, Kiwis can jingle, mingle and dine at Woolworths Christmas Table – a fun night of festive feasting with Trudi “The Foodie” Nelson sharing all the best tips and tricks for hosting Christmas at home. 

Tickets are only $30 each, which includes a three-course meal and all beverages with all sales going straight to The Salvation Army’s Christmas Appeal.

Rising culinary star, 19-year-old Emily Morgan has been handpicked to design the decadent menu which guests can enjoy at The Tuesday Club in Auckland.

The award-winning teen has used nothing but Woolworths Own food range and fresh seasonal produce for the three-course meal to show that everyone can create a memorable feast to share with those who matter most.

The menu will give guests a taste of what’s possible when you combine creativity and quality ingredients.

Starters include zucchini and corn fritters, perfectly paired with a zingy avocado and lime cream, and mains feature a Christmas centrepiece protein line-up that’ll have mouths watering: slow-cooked lamb leg, chargrilled harissa chicken, lemon and caper baked salmon, and Woolworths’ award-winning Christmas ham.

Fresh summer salads and exquisite sides will complete the main course followed by dessert – a platter of Woolworths’ iconic Christmas cakes, pies, and puddings, wrapping up the evening in sweet style.
